1. 檢查日志文件:MySQL日志文件中記錄了MySQL進程的運行情況,可以檢查日志文件中是否有異常信息,例如錯誤、警告等。通過日志文件可以快速定位問題,
2. 檢查系統(tǒng)資源:MySQL進程的運行需要消耗一定的系統(tǒng)資源,例如CPU、內存等。如果系統(tǒng)資源不足,可以通過系統(tǒng)監(jiān)控工具檢查系統(tǒng)資源的使用情況,找出是否有資源瓶頸,
3. 檢查MySQL配置文件:MySQL的配置文件中保存了MySQL的各種配置參數(shù),例如緩存大小、并發(fā)連接數(shù)等。如果配置不當,可以檢查配置文件中的參數(shù)是否合理,并根據(jù)需要進行調整。
4. 檢查MySQL版本:MySQL的不同版本對應著不同的功能和性能,如果使用的是較老的版本,可能會存在一些已知的Bug,導致MySQL進程崩潰。可以考慮升級到較新的版本,以獲得更好的穩(wěn)定性和性能。
noDB、MyISAM等。不同的存儲引擎對應著不同的特性和性能,如果使用的存儲引擎不合適,可以根據(jù)實際需求選擇合適的存儲引擎。
6. 檢查MySQL操作:MySQL的操作也可能導致MySQL進程崩潰,例如執(zhí)行復雜的查詢語句、修改大量數(shù)據(jù)等。可以優(yōu)化操作方式,減少對MySQL進程的負載,以提高穩(wěn)定性。
總之,解決MySQL進程突然終止的問題需要綜合考慮各種因素,在使用MySQL時,需要注意配置參數(shù)、存儲引擎、操作方式等方面,以提高MySQL的穩(wěn)定性和性能。